Discussions to resolve national issues by United government over : parliament maiden session on 1 st -Malik

(Lanka-e-News -27.Aug.2015, 4.25PM) The  United government ,a long felt necessity of  paramount national importance ,aimed at  resolving vital national issues , formed between UNP and SLFP after cordial and extensive discussions between the two parties has reached a happy harmonious concord , said UNP president and UNP national list M.P. Malik Samarawickrema while issuing an official communique on behalf of the UNP.

Based on reports , the main cabinet of ministers are to take oaths later, and according to the 19 th amendment the cabinet should comprise 30 members, however if a national caninet is to be formed , that number can be increased to 50 under the provisions.

The parliament maiden session will be on the 1 st of September  when the speaker , deputy speaker and the leader of the house will be   appointed . Subsequently , the MPs will take oaths before the speaker .President Maithripala is slated to  address the Parliament at 3.00 p.m.on that  day.
The next day ,after the parliament ratification is obtained to increase the  cabinet members , the new cabinet will be sworn in.

Mr. Malik Samarawickrema's  official communique as follows

The United National Party during the election campaigns of the last Presidential and Parliamentary elections consistently stated that the entire Parliament would comprise the new government thus creating a new political culture and a system of a civilized form of governance.

We also stated that we would form a national government at least for a period of two years to achieve this goal. Accordingly, a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) was signed recently with the Sri Lanka Freedom Party. 

We came to an agreement subsequent to the friendly and comprehensive discussions held with the Sri Lanka Freedom Party to form a national government.

The prime objective of the two parties is to serve the people. We joined hands to nurture the future of our nation without clinging on to our traditional political ideologies. Our prime concern has been to elevate the motherland to a higher echelon of development and not about ministerial portfolios and other perquisites  

In this exercise both parties had to make sacrifices. All our sacrifices were made with the intention of creating a better future for our country.

We are committed to work devotedly towards creating a new country within a period of 60 months through a new Cabinet and a new Parliament.
